ABSTRACT:
The invention relates to medicine and veterinary. The device for magnetotherapy comprises a variable generator (1) of current pulses, an energy accumulator (2) and a circuit (3) for discharge of the energy accumulator (2), including a controlled switching element (5) and an inductor (4) capable of producing a therapeutic pulsed magnetic field, and also a unit (7) for controlling the duration of pulses of the magnetic field produced by the inductor (4) and a controller (10) of the amplitude of pulses of the magnetic field. According to the invention, the discharge circuit (3) of the energy accumulator (2) includes a unit (6) for controlling the slope of the leading edge of pulses of the magnetic field produced by the inductor (4). The device is predominantly intended for arresting and relieving acute pain syndromes, phantom limb pain and attacks of bronchial asthma, and also for treating mastities of cattle.
